:root{--space-1: 4px;--space-2: 8px;--space-3: 12px;--space-4: 16px;--bg-light: #f8fafc;--bg-dark: #0f172a;--text-light: #1e293b;--scrollbar-width: 8px;--scrollbar-bg: #f1f5f9;--scrollbar-thumb: #cbd5e1;--scrollbar-thumb-hover: #94a3b8;--radius: 12px;--transition: .25s ease}html{scroll-behavior:smooth;-webkit-tap-highlight-color:transparent}body{margin:0;padding:0;background:var(--bg-light);color:var(--text-light);overflow-x:hidden;font-family:Inter,sans-serif;transition:background var(--transition),color var(--transition)}img{-webkit-user-drag:none;-webkit-user-select:none;user-select:none;image-rendering:-webkit-optimize-contrast}::-webkit-scrollbar{width:var(--scrollbar-width);height:var(--scrollbar-width)}::-webkit-scrollbar-track{background:var(--scrollbar-bg)}::-webkit-scrollbar-thumb{background-color:var(--scrollbar-thumb);border-radius:20px;border:2px solid var(--scrollbar-bg);transition:background var(--transition)}::-webkit-scrollbar-thumb:hover{background-color:var(--scrollbar-thumb-hover)}h1,h2,h3,h4,h5,h6{font-feature-settings:"cv11","ss01";font-family:Inter,sans-serif;letter-spacing:-.5px}::selection{background:#c7d2fe;color:#1e293b}*{transition:all var(--transition)}
